Manitoba Open SF: Cardenas and Baillargeon Through
The final of the Oasis Pools & Spas Manitoba Open is set, with Mexico’s Leonel Cardenas and Canadian David Baillargeon through to Sunday’s contest.
Cardenas is the top seed for the Challenger 10 level competition, and in the semi-finals, he took on Spaniard Ivan Perez. Despite the Mexican winning in straight games, the pair were on court for almost an hour. Cardenas eventually got the job done 11-8, 11-4, 11-7 in 55 minutes to move through to the final.
He will now take on home favourite David Baillargeon in the final on Sunday. The Canadian No.1 also won in straight games in the last four, but in much easier circumstances. He played England’s Ben Smith, and dropped just nine points in a comfortable 11-4, 11-3, 11-2 victory.

Semi-Final Results: Oasis Pools & Spas Manitoba Open
[1] Leonel Cardenas (MEX) bt [6] Ivan Perez (ESP) 3-0: 11-8, 11-4, 11-7 (55m)
[2] David Baillargeon (CAN) bt [4] Ben Smith (ENG) 3-0: 11-4, 11-3, 11-2 (28m)
